When Cheek left the phase, she had a fresh $1 million commitment from financier Lori Greiner. And the company is wowing more than simply the television judges. Everly, Well gathered $6 million in sales in 2015, a spokeswoman stated, and Cheek told the judges that this year they anticipated that to double.

All are considered laboratory-developed tests, and are for that reason not controlled by the Fda. ad Yet doctor groups have actually for years advised versus using immunoglobulin G tests to examine for so-called food level of sensitivities or intolerances. And allergy professionals told STAT that the test is ineffective at finest and might even trigger damage if it leads customers to needlessly cut nutritious foods from their diet plan.

Food level of sensitivity is an umbrella term that includes symptoms that can arise, for instance, from trouble absorbing a food, as in lactose intolerance, or susceptibility to the result of a food, as in caffeine level of sensitivity. These signs, nevertheless, do not involve an immune reaction. Dr. Martha Hartz, a specialist at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minn., states she frequently examines clients who've currently dished out the cash for the screening. "Anytime I see a client who's had these sort of tests, we get them to toss it aside," Hartz said.

It is simply not a test that needs to done." Everly, Well's food level of sensitivity test utilizes a blood sample to try to find immune system activity. Everly, Well Everly, Well's test is just one entry to the flourishing field of at-home testing. Along with players in the hereditary area, such as 23and, Me and Color Genomics, upstarts are taking objective at basic medical screening.

Everly, Well's food level of sensitivity tests make use of a frustrating reality for those questioning whether their signs come from the food they consume: There is no easy method to discover a response. The doctor-advised technique is to cut common culprits from the diet one by one a so-called removal diet however that is troublesome, time-consuming, and, by its very nature, limiting.

Your body can respond to a "problematic" food in numerous various methods, and how your body responds to that food depends upon whether you have a food sensitivity, food intolerance, or food allergic reaction. It's not unusual for confusion to exist around the fact that allergies, intolerances, and level of sensitivities aren't interchangeable.

Food Sensitivity A food level of sensitivity might result from a kind of immune system action that's extremely various than a food allergic reaction. While not completely understood, research study has revealed that individuals might recognize symptom-causing foods utilizing the outcomes of Ig, G screening along with an elimination diet. Ig, G antibody reactions versus those foods may be typical in some people, but in others it might trigger signs due to the fact that of the swelling the immune reaction produces from those interactions.

If the lack of scientific backing is not sufficient to encourage you to go to an expert rather, the fact that there is no support likewise means that taking an at-home food sensitivity test will just show a trouble. As Excellent, RX Health notes, you will need to spend for a test and after that in all possibility, have to take a test when you go to the specialist anyway - julia cheeks everlywell.

As the licensed diet professional Tamara Duker Freuman wrote in a piece for Self, a professional would rather you not take a test prior to seeing them. That's because they have to dispel any notions that the test had provided the client. The very best case circumstances are those in which the client listens.

Customer Reviews: Everlywell Food Sensitivity Test - Cvs

Worst case scenarios involve patients who purchased into the results of food level of sensitivity tests completely - julia cheeks everlywell. "I've enjoyed helplessly as my client vanishes down a bunny hole of food limitation and avoidance that can, for some people, cause disordered consuming," Freuman shared, explaining how clients assume they simply require to get rid of more food from their diet plan.
